Faculty Spotlight

Dr. Joe Hahn, Professor

Dr. Hahn's research interests include decision analysis and numerical approaches to modeling optimal managerial decision-making and its effect on project valuation, with application to investments in energy exploration and production.

John Butler, Director, MS Finance

John Butler is a Clinical Associate Professor and Director of Finance at the McCombs School of Business.

Dr. Laura Starks, Professor

Dr. Starks teaches undergraduate and graduate courses on environmental, social and governance investing, philanthropy, global financial strategies, and other finance topics.
